Overview of Vacuum Single Cone Spiral Belt Drying Machine Equipment
Multi purpose vacuum single cone dryer is an efficient and multifunctional fully enclosed vertical vacuum drying equipment that integrates vacuum distillation, crushing, powder mixing, and drying. Its drying efficiency is 3-5 times that of double cone rotary vacuum dryers and vacuum box dryers of the same specifications.
The working process of the vacuum single cone dryer is batch operation. After the wet material enters the silo, it is dried using a jacket, stirring and heating. The high vacuum design of this dryer has significant advantages for temperature sensitive products, with good thermal conductivity, fast drying, and low energy consumption. The filter directly connected to the dryer can retain dust particles in the processing area. The machine adopts an inflatable sealed hemispherical valve for thorough and convenient unloading, excellent vacuum and pressure sealing performance, no dead corners, easy to clean design, stable performance, and long service life, ensuring that products can continue to be processed without any damage.

1. Blender: Using a low shear force helical stirrer blade, gently mix materials at low speed and low energy consumption. The intensity and mixing time of the mixture are relatively low.
2. Cylinder: The cylinder consists of a head and a conical cylinder. The head and cylinder are equipped with jacket heating and insulation, and necessary manholes, process pipe openings, and sight glasses are provided. Equipped with agitator shaft seal, bottom discharge valve, upper feed valve, and dust filter.
3. Dust filter: The dust filter consists of an insulated and heated outer cylinder, a filter element, a blowback and cleaning device.
4. Machine sealing system: The machine sealing liquid is used as an external liquid barrier and a safe machine sealing indicator system. The mechanical sealing products and connecting components comply with GMP standards, and the tank is filled with sterile water liquid for operation. It can be circulated and completely emptied. The liquid system operates in accordance with GMP standards.
5. Inflatable sealed hemispherical valve: This hemispherical valve is designed to meet the special needs of feeding and discharging in single cone vacuum dryers. The valve is manufactured according to precise tolerance standards and combined with a special structure to form a good vacuum and pressure sealing environment. The standard inflatable sealed design has no dead corners, is easy to clean, meets GM standards, and can be cleaned online.

1. Strong applicability: Combined with our company's special drying process, it can adapt to the drying of materials with high viscosity, poor thermal penetration, easy rolling and clumping.
2. Large production capacity: Large loading capacity, which can reach the effective volume of the container.
3. High drying efficiency: The effective heat transfer area is large, which is 1.4 times the area inside the container; The material rises in a spiral shape inside the device, then descends in a vortex shape along the main axis, and is uniformly and effectively heated during dispersed motion; The combination of high vacuum at the machine head and high-speed pulse airflow at the same temperature and direction at the machine bottom effectively removes the solvent of the material; The dual channel vacuum nozzle prevents vacuum blockage, reduces resistance, and increases pumping rate. With a back blowing trap, it can effectively provide high vacuum.
4. Not damaging the crystal structure of materials: Materials with high thermal sensitivity and crystal structure requirements will not be damaged.
5. The drying process is fully sealed and nitrogen filled, with no cross contamination, high cleanliness, and high safety level.
6. The mixer and container wall have high smoothness and a small gap between them, which can effectively prevent materials from sticking to the surface of the container wall.
7. Satisfy the production requirements of sterile raw materials: online SIP and CIP, as well as online sterile sampling, can be optionally selected, and a PLC intelligent control recording device can be configured to record, store, and transport process parameters related to the drying process. Sealed connection with the upper and lower processes, the entire production process is produced in a closed manner, meeting the requirements of the new GMP production.
